Addressing conservatives, Huntsman calls for big tent GOP

The opinions expressed by columnists are their own and do not necessarily represent the views of Townhall.com.
Orlando (CNN) - Former Utah Gov. Jon Huntsman made a pitch for big tent Republicanism in a convention hall packed with hardcore Florida conservatives on Friday. And the crowd applauded. Politely, at least. "We must appeal to the tea party and to conservative Republicans, but we must also bring into the tent moderate Republicans, independents and yes, conservative Democrats," Huntsman told an audience at the Conservative Political Action Conference in Orlando. Building a broad coalition is the only way to win a general election against President Barack Obama in 2012, he argued.
